Building the Future of STEM
YMRF is a newly launched nonprofit with a bold mission: to make research accessible to high school students everywhere.
Our Vision
A world where every high school student with curiosity and drive has access to real research experiences that shape their future in STEM.
What We're Building
Mentorship programs, STEM boot camps, hackathons, and a student research conference — all designed to give young minds hands-on exposure to real science.
Why It Matters
Early research experience builds critical thinking, strengthens college applications, and opens doors to scholarships and careers in STEM fields.
